Найти положение целевого узла на основе якорного узла в BLE - PullRequest
2 голосов
/ 20 июня 2019

У меня есть три позиции узлов привязки, и целевой узел непрерывно отправляет значение RSSI узлу привязки.Используя это, Как я могу вычислить позицию целевого узла?

Я наткнулся на эту ссылку .Они использовали метод наименьших квадратов, чтобы найти «n» и «c».Используя полученные "n" и "c", вычисляется расстояние от целевого узла до якорного узла, а затем используется метод трилатерации для нахождения координат целевого узла.

Теперь мой вопрос таков:мы вручную определяем значение RSSI для каждого расстояния и вводим то же самое в наименьших квадратах, чтобы найти «n» и «c»?Как реализовать то же самое в python?

Поскольку у нас есть три узла привязки, достаточно ли собирать RSSI для каждого расстояния на основе одного узла привязки, чтобы найти «n» и «c» в наименьшем квадрате?

...